【JavaScriptOPP基础】【成员属性与成员方法】【原型与原型链】【原型属性与原型方法】【for-in循环】【JS OOP 中的继承】【JS模式实现继承的三种方式】【闭包】 ...
分类:
编程语言 时间:
2017-05-15 00:33:43
阅读次数:
239
离开博客园很久了,自从找到工作,到现在基本没有再写过博客了。在大学培养起来的写博客的习惯在慢慢的消失殆尽,感觉汗颜。所以现在要开始重新培养起这个习惯,定期写博客不仅是对自己学习知识的一种沉淀,更是在督促自己要不断的学习,不断的进步。 最近在进一步学习Java并发编程,不言而喻,这部分内容是很重要的。 ...
分类:
编程语言 时间:
2017-05-15 00:33:52
阅读次数:
231
前言 在企业安全建设专题中偶尔有次提到算法的应用,不少同学想深入了解这块,所以我专门开了一个子专题用于介绍安全领域经常用到的机器学习模型,从入门级别的SVM、贝叶斯等到HMM、神经网络和深度学习(其实深度学习可以认为就是神经网络的加强版)。 关联规则挖掘 关联规则挖掘通常是无监督学习,通过分析数据集 ...
分类:
编程语言 时间:
2017-05-15 00:34:11
阅读次数:
209
maven中的profile概念,在spring-boot中一样适合,只要约定以下几个规则即可: 一、不同环境的配置文件以"application-环境名.yml"命名 举个粟子: 如果有二个环境dev、prod,项目工程中有上述二个文件即可。 二、主配置文件application.yml中,显式激 ...
分类:
编程语言 时间:
2017-05-15 00:34:27
阅读次数:
365
在工作中遇到了深浅复制的问题,所以详细总结一下: 深复制和浅复制只针对像 Object, Array 这样的复杂对象的。简单来说,浅复制只复制一层对象的属性,而深复制则递归复制了所有层级。 这是一种典型的浅复制,shadowCopy方法将对象的各个属性进行依次复制,并不会进行递归复制,而 JavaS ...
分类:
编程语言 时间:
2017-05-15 00:34:42
阅读次数:
271
前言 在企业安全建设专题中偶尔有次提到算法的应用,不少同学想深入了解这块,所以我专门开了一个子专题用于介绍安全领域经常用到的机器学习模型,从入门级别的SVM、贝叶斯等到HMM、神经网络和深度学习(其实深度学习可以认为就是神经网络的加强版)。 规则VS算法 传统安全几乎把规则的能力基本发挥到了极致,成 ...
分类:
编程语言 时间:
2017-05-15 00:35:21
阅读次数:
266
上节介绍了如何搭建selenium 系统环境,那么本节来讲一下如何开始编写第一个自动化测试脚本。 Selenium2.x 将浏览器原生的API封装成WebDriver API,可以直接操作浏览器页面里的元素,甚至操作浏览器本身(截屏,窗口大小,启动,关闭,安装插件,配置证书之类的),所以就像真正的用 ...
分类:
编程语言 时间:
2017-05-15 00:35:31
阅读次数:
243
1、正则声明: var reg = /abc/; var reg = new RegExp('abc'); 2、转义: \d:任何数字; \D:非数字; \w:字母,数字,下划线; \W:非字母,非数字,非下划线; \s:空格; \S:非空格 3、量词: {m,n}:大于等于m次,小于等于n次; { ...
分类:
编程语言 时间:
2017-05-15 00:35:37
阅读次数:
146
现在有一批手机,其中颜色有['白色','黑色','金色','粉红色'];内存大小有['16G','32G','64G','128G'],版本有['移动','联通','电信'],要求写一个算法,实现[['白色','16G','移动'], ['白色','16G','联通'] ...]这样的组合,扩张,如 ...
分类:
编程语言 时间:
2017-05-15 00:36:21
阅读次数:
306
目标: 1,掌握SYStem对IO的三种支持: system.out system.in system.err 2,掌握system.out及system.err的区别。 3,掌握输入,输出重定向。 System类的常量 java给system类对IO有一定支持,预制了三个常量。 PrintStre ...
分类:
编程语言 时间:
2017-05-15 00:36:57
阅读次数:
298
File 类的介绍:http://www.cnblogs.com/ysocean/p/6851878.html Java IO 流的分类介绍:http://www.cnblogs.com/ysocean/p/6854098.html 那么这篇博客我们讲的是字节输入输出流:InputStream、Ou ...
分类:
编程语言 时间:
2017-05-15 00:37:59
阅读次数:
224
一.文件操作 打开文件的方式有: r,只读模式(默认) w,只写模式(不可读;不存在则创建;存在则删除内容;) a,追加模式(可读; 不存在则创建;存在则只追加内容;) "+"表示可以同时读写某个文件 r+,可读写文件(可读;可写) w+,写读文件(可写;可读) a+,同a "b"表示处理二进制文件 ...
分类:
编程语言 时间:
2017-05-15 00:38:33
阅读次数:
141
命名实体识别 命名实体的提出源自信息抽取问题,即从报章等非结构化文本中抽取关于公司活动和国防相关活动的结构化信息,而人名、地名、组织机构名、时间和数字表达式结构化信息的关键内容,所以需要从文本中去识别这些实体指称及其类别,即命名实体识别和分类。 21世纪以后,基于大规模语料库的统计方法成为自然语言处 ...
分类:
编程语言 时间:
2017-05-15 00:38:59
阅读次数:
3143
最近比较迷Python,仿照《Python编程快速上手》8.5写了一个随机出卷的小程序。程序本身并不难,关键是解决问题的思路,还有就是顺便复习了一下全国地名(缅怀一下周总理)。 OK其实还是有一个难点的,就是关于Python的中文编码问题,如何把中文字典输入到txt然后再把它读出来,程序中借用了js ...
分类:
编程语言 时间:
2017-05-15 00:39:48
阅读次数:
285
SpringMVC的四个基本注解annotation(控制层,业务层,持久层) -- @Component、@Repository @Service、@Controller SpringMVC中四个基本注解: @Component、@Repository @Service、@Controller 看 ...
分类:
编程语言 时间:
2017-05-15 00:40:03
阅读次数:
240
Given an array with n integers, you need to find if there are triplets (i, j, k) which satisfies following conditions: where we define that subarray ( ...
分类:
编程语言 时间:
2017-05-15 00:42:43
阅读次数:
222
Don't use get to initialize or assign another smart pointer. The code that use the return from get can not delete the pointer Although the compiler wi ...
分类:
编程语言 时间:
2017-05-15 00:43:50
阅读次数:
200
非线性回归是在对变量的非线性关系有一定认识前提下,对非线性函数的参数进行最优化的过程,最优化后的参数会使得模型的RSS(残差平方和)达到最小。在R语言中最为常用的非线性回归建模函数是nls,下面以car包中的USPop数据集为例来讲解其用法。数据中population表示人口数,year表示年份。如 ...
分类:
编程语言 时间:
2017-05-15 00:44:12
阅读次数:
1242
package com.fh.util; import java.util.ArrayList; import java.util.Collections; import java.util.Comparator; import java.util.HashMap; import java.util... ...
分类:
编程语言 时间:
2017-05-15 09:47:51
阅读次数:
246
前言 隐式马尔可夫(HMM),也称韩梅梅,广泛应用于语音识别、文本处理以及网络安全等领域,2009年I Corona,D Ariu,G Giacinto三位大神关于HMM应用于web安全领域的研究论文,让HMM逐渐被各大安全厂商重视。本篇重点介绍HMM最常见同时也比较基础的基于url参数异常检测的应 ...
分类:
编程语言 时间:
2017-05-15 09:48:35
阅读次数:
242